  Binary package hint: xserver-xorg-video-ati
  
  I've a problem using Ati Radeon 9250 on Ubuntu 8.04 with open source driver: 
very often, after splash screen monitor shows me "no signal" message and it 
goes to standby mode. I checked Xorg.0.log when xserver starts correctly and 
when it doesn't and I've seen two differences:
  1) Some memory area (Ring, GART, Vertex buffers,etc...) are mapped to 
different addresses
  2) When "no signal" message is shown log ends with 
  
  (II) RADEON(0): no multimedia table present, disabling Rage Theatre.
  
  while when X starts without problems the log  continues.
  
  I attach Xorg.0.log in both cases: working and bugged, and my xorg.conf.
